What wave has a shorter wavelength AM or FM?

Generally, the wavelength of an FM signal is shorter than an AM signal. A typical FM broadcast band is 88-108 MHz, while a typical AM broadcast band is 540-1660 KHz, making the FM signal wavelength 100 times shorter.

What is the wavelength of a soundwave wave with a frequency of 256 hertz?

The speed of sound c is wavelength lambda times frequency f. The speed of sound in air of 20 degrees Celsius or 68 degrees Fahrenheit is 343 meters per second. Wavelength lambda = Speed of sound c divided by frequency f. The wavelength is 343 / 256 = 1.34 meters.

How long in meters is a typical radio wave which has a frequency of 560 kilohertz?

Well, consider that a wave's wavelength is equivalent to its velocity multiplied divided by its frequency. If we make the fairly safe assumption that it travels at 3 x 10^8 meters per second (the speed of electromagnetic radiation in a vacuum), we can calculate its wavelength as (3 x 10^8)/560000 or 535.7 meters

Is chlorine a monatomic at room temperature?

No, chlorine typically exists as a diatomic molecule at room temperature. Monatomic chlorine is a free radical and is very reactive. Thus, chlorine atoms in elemental chlorine are almost always bonded to one another under typical conditions.
